Following the Early Years Foundation Stage guidance, the children experience stimulating and varied activities each day. Don’t be surprised to learn that your child has spent time playing with jelly, foam or paint – messy play encourages learning and is fun! Whilst emphasis is on play, listening to stories, music, IT and expressing themselves freely in art all help with the development of language, literacy, numeracy and social skills which enable them to become active independent learners. Children learn to share, take turns, have fun and form friendships that can last throughout the school. The Swans sit down together at lunchtime and can enjoy a freshly cooked nutritious meal. Good manners are important and the children are encouraged to say ‘please’ and ‘thank you’ at every opportunity. Outdoor play is part of everyday life at Mayville Nursery. A safety surface playground with a variety of exciting equipment and a sensory garden area, allows the Swans to experience a wealth of learning opportunities in a safe and secure environment. In addition, frequent trips out allow them to experience the wider community in which they live. We are open 50 weeks of the year (8am – 6pm).
